WorldVQA

Overview

WorldVQA is a benchmark designed to evaluate the atomic visual world knowledge of Multimodal Large Language Models (MLLMs). It measures models' ability to ground and name visual entities across a stratified taxonomy, spanning from common head-class objects to long-tail rarities.

Task Description

  • Task Type: Visual Entity Recognition / Knowledge QA
  • Input: Image + question asking to identify a visual entity
  • Output: Free-form text answer (specific entity name)
  • Domain: Nature, architecture, culture, products, transportation, entertainment, brands, sports

Key Features

  • 3000 VQA pairs across 8 semantic categories
  • Bilingual: English (non-zh) and Chinese (zh)
  • Three difficulty levels: easy, medium, hard
  • Tests atomic visual knowledge decoupled from reasoning
  • Requires precise entity identification (e.g., specific breed, not generic "dog")

Evaluation Notes

  • Default configuration uses 0-shot evaluation
  • Evaluates on train split (the benchmark data split)
  • Primary metric: Accuracy via LLM-as-judge
  • Supports LLM judge for semantic equivalence checking
  • Results reported per category and overall

Data Statistics

Metric Value
Total Samples 3,000
Prompt Length (Mean) 38.4 chars
Prompt Length (Min/Max) 5 / 182 chars

Per-Subset Statistics:

Subset Samples Prompt Mean Prompt Min Prompt Max
Nature & Environment 326 33.9 7 83
Locations & Architecture 512 42.03 9 122
Culture, Arts & Crafts 506 33.71 7 112
Objects & Products 437 55.97 9 182
Vehicles, Craft & Transportation 306 30.67 8 114
Entertainment, Media & Gaming 511 30.5 5 83
Brands, Logos & Graphic Design 260 39.1 6 83
Sports, Gear & Venues 142 41.99 9 100

Image Statistics:

Metric Value
Total Images 3,000
Images per Sample min: 1, max: 1, mean: 1
Resolution Range 33x65 - 3840x3840
Formats gif, jpeg, png, webp

Usage

Using CLI

evalscope eval \
    --model YOUR_MODEL \
    --api-url OPENAI_API_COMPAT_URL \
    --api-key EMPTY_TOKEN \
    --datasets world_vqa \
    --limit 10  # Remove this line for formal evaluation

Using Python

from evalscope import run_task
from evalscope.config import TaskConfig

task_cfg = TaskConfig(
    model='YOUR_MODEL',
    api_url='OPENAI_API_COMPAT_URL',
    api_key='EMPTY_TOKEN',
    datasets=['world_vqa'],
    dataset_args={
        'world_vqa': {
            # subset_list: ['Nature & Environment', 'Locations & Architecture', 'Culture, Arts & Crafts']  # optional, evaluate specific subsets
        }
    },
    limit=10,  # Remove this line for formal evaluation
)

run_task(task_cfg=task_cfg)
